Discover a sparkling region in Southern Italy which offers the most
tantalizing food, through 75 authentic recipes, cooked with care
and attention using the best ingredients. Italian food reflects
culture. In Italy cooking is the product of geography, history, and
religion. ‘Italian cooking’ is really a patchwork of local and
regional cuisines, all fiercely claiming to be the best in the
country. Ursula Ferrigno’s own family come from the south of
Italy, and just south of Naples is the Amalfi Coast. It is widely
considered to be one of Italy’s most magical locations:
breath-taking (literally) winding cliff-top roads, pastel-coloured
houses tumbling down towards the sea, flower-framed terraces and
trees heavy with the world’s most coveted lemons at every turn.
Discover the delicious food the region has to offer. Vegetable
dishes take centre stage and both meat and fish are eaten and often
combined. In this seductive book you’ll find 75 recipes to enjoy,
from simple antipasti and ministre (soups) to pane (bread) and
pizza, risotto, pollame and carne (fish and meat), and the
all-important contorni (vegetable), alongside essays on the food
culture and traditions of the area and beautiful scenic
photography.
